URL-адрес изменяется после использования параметров в маршрутизаторе реагировать с избыточностью - PullRequest
0 голосов
/ 23 октября 2018

Я новичок в реакции редукса.Итак, у меня есть этот маршрут

<PrivateRoute exact path="/quiz-setup/:job" component={QuizSetupMain} />

Итак, в действии я звоню

history.push({
      pathname: '/quiz-setup/'+`${this.props.selectedJdName}`
    })

Теперь

return hasUserLogIn ?
    (
      <Route
        {...rest}
        path={path}
        component={Component}
      />
    )
    :
    (
      <Redirect
        to={{
          pathname: "/login",
          state: { from: path }
        }}
      />
    )

Итак, здесь, когда маршрут

как

http://localhost:3000/quiz-setup/ganesh1

в тот момент, когда два запроса идут один, который находится в некоторых других компонентах receiveprops, и один находится в этом компоненте, теперь здесь нет, URL-адрес для первого изменяется на

http://localhost:3000/quiz-setup/api/

quiz-setup gets added in that url so that I get `404`. for the same receiveprops it hits the proper url can any one help me with this ? 
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...